  1. """Fan adv parser."""
  2. from __future__ import annotations
  3. from ..const.fan import FanMode, StandingFanMode
  4. _FAN_MODE_MAP: dict[int, str] = {m.value: m.name.lower() for m in FanMode}
  5. _STANDING_FAN_MODE_MAP: dict[int, str] = {
  6. m.value: m.name.lower() for m in StandingFanMode
  7. }
  8. def _parse_fan(
  9. mfr_data: bytes | None, mode_map: dict[int, str]
  10. ) -> dict[str, bool | int | str | None]:
  11. """Shared fan advertisement parse, parameterized on the mode map."""
  12. if mfr_data is None:
  13. return {}
  14. device_data = mfr_data[6:]
  15. _seq_num = device_data[0]
  16. _isOn = bool(device_data[1] & 0b10000000)
  17. _mode = (device_data[1] & 0b01110000) >> 4
  18. _nightLight = (device_data[1] & 0b00001100) >> 2
  19. _oscillate_left_and_right = bool(device_data[1] & 0b00000010)
  20. _oscillate_up_and_down = bool(device_data[1] & 0b00000001)
  21. _battery = device_data[2] & 0b01111111
  22. _speed = device_data[3] & 0b01111111
  23. return {
  24. "sequence_number": _seq_num,
  25. "isOn": _isOn,
  26. "mode": mode_map.get(_mode),
  27. "nightLight": _nightLight,
  28. "oscillating": _oscillate_left_and_right or _oscillate_up_and_down,
  29. "oscillating_horizontal": _oscillate_left_and_right,
  30. "oscillating_vertical": _oscillate_up_and_down,
  31. "battery": _battery,
  32. "speed": _speed,
  33. }
  34. def process_fan(
  35. data: bytes | None, mfr_data: bytes | None
  36. ) -> dict[str, bool | int | str | None]:
  37. """Process Circulator Fan services data (modes 1-4)."""
  38. return _parse_fan(mfr_data, _FAN_MODE_MAP)
  39. def process_standing_fan(
  40. data: bytes | None, mfr_data: bytes | None
  41. ) -> dict[str, bool | int | str | None]:
  42. """Process Standing Fan services data (modes 1-5; adds CUSTOM_NATURAL)."""
  43. return _parse_fan(mfr_data, _STANDING_FAN_MODE_MAP)
